BSI BS ISO 1998-6:2000

This part of ISO 1998 introduces a list of equivalent English and French terms, in use in the petroleum industry to indicate the measurement of crude oils and petroleum products, together with the corresponding definitions in the two languages.

ISO 1998 is intended to cover the purposes of this part of petroleum industry dealing with crude oils and petroleum products, that means all related operations arising from the production field to the final user. It is not intended to cover either petroleum equipment, or any operation in the field. However some pieces of equipment or some operations of exploration and production are defined. The corresponding terms were introduced only when they appear in a definition of a product or process and when their definition was found necessary for understanding or for avoiding any ambiguity. Where a terminology of petroleum equipment is needed, it corresponds to the scope of ISO/TC 67 Materials, equipment and offshore structures for petroleum and natural gas industries.
